Creative puns have played an important role in literature and storytelling throughout history. Many famous writers and poets have used wordplay to add humor, develop characters, and create deeper meanings within their works. Authors often include puns in titles, conversations, character names, and descriptions to make their writing more interesting and engaging. Wordplay allows writers to communicate multiple ideas at the same time, giving readers an opportunity to discover hidden meanings.
